Surface Preparation: Sanding, priming, and filling gaps for a smooth, paint-ready T-Rex surface
3D printing a T-Rex model is just the first step in bringing your prehistoric creation to life. The surface straight out of the printer is often riddled with imperfections: layer lines, rough textures, and tiny gaps that can ruin the final paint job. Surface preparation is the unsung hero of the painting process, transforming a raw print into a canvas worthy of your artistic vision.
Skip this step, and your T-Rex will look like it's been through a time warp, emerging worse for wear.
Sanding: The Foundation of Smoothness
Imagine your T-Rex's skin, not scaly and rough, but smooth and ready for a vibrant coat of paint. This is where sanding comes in. Start with a coarse grit sandpaper (around 220-grit) to tackle those prominent layer lines. Work in circular motions, applying even pressure to avoid creating new imperfections. Gradually progress to finer grits (400-grit and above) for a progressively smoother finish. Think of it as exfoliating your T-Rex's skin, revealing the sleek surface beneath. Remember, patience is key; rushing this step will only lead to frustration and an uneven surface.
For intricate details like teeth and claws, consider using sanding sticks or fine-grit emery boards for precision.
Priming: The Canvas for Color
Once your T-Rex is smooth to the touch, it's time for primer. Primer acts as a bridge between the plastic and the paint, ensuring better adhesion and a more even color application. Choose a primer specifically formulated for plastic models, available in spray cans or brush-on varieties. Spray primers offer a finer finish but require proper ventilation and masking to avoid overspray. Brush-on primers are more forgiving but can leave brush strokes if not applied carefully. Apply thin, even coats, allowing each layer to dry completely before adding the next. A good rule of thumb is to apply 2-3 thin coats for optimal coverage.
Filling Gaps: Banishing Imperfections
Even the best 3D prints can have tiny gaps or imperfections. These can be easily addressed with filler putty, a modeling essential. Choose a two-part epoxy putty or a polyester-based filler, both readily available at hobby stores. Knead the putty until it's a uniform color, then press it into the gap, smoothing it with a damp finger or a small spatula. Allow the putty to dry completely before sanding it smooth, blending it seamlessly with the surrounding surface. For larger gaps, consider using a cyanoacrylate glue (super glue) with baking soda to create a quick-drying filler. Remember, less is more; apply filler sparingly and sand carefully to avoid removing too much material.
With careful sanding, priming, and gap filling, your 3D printed T-Rex will be transformed from a rough print into a smooth, paint-ready canvas, ready to roar to life with color and detail.

Base Coat Application: Choosing and applying the initial color layer evenly across the model
The base coat is the foundation of your T-Rex's final look, so choosing the right color and applying it evenly is crucial. Think of it as the canvas upon which all subsequent details will be built. A poorly applied base coat will show through, ruining the illusion of a realistic or stylized dinosaur.
Opt for a color that complements your desired final aesthetic. For a natural look, earthy tones like greens, browns, and greys are popular choices, mimicking the T-Rex's potential environment. If you're going for a more fantastical approach, consider bold colors like reds, blues, or even metallics.
Application technique is key to achieving an even base coat. Start by thinning your paint with a suitable medium (water for acrylics, mineral spirits for oils) to a milk-like consistency. This allows for smoother application and prevents the paint from obscuring fine details. Use a large, flat brush to apply the paint in thin, even strokes, following the direction of the model's texture. Work in sections, allowing each area to dry before moving on to the next to avoid smudging.
Remember, patience is paramount. Multiple thin coats are better than one thick, gloopy layer. Aim for a consistent opacity, ensuring complete coverage without drowning the details.
Consider the material of your 3D printed T-Rex. Some plastics may require a primer to ensure proper paint adhesion. A light sanding with fine-grit sandpaper can also improve surface texture for better paint grip.
Finally, don't be afraid to experiment. Try different brush techniques, like dry brushing for a weathered look or stippling for a textured effect, to add depth and dimension to your base coat. The possibilities are as vast as your imagination.

Detailing Techniques: Highlighting scales, teeth, and claws with precision brushes and contrasting shades
The devil is in the details when painting a 3D printed T-Rex, and nowhere is this more evident than in the scales, teeth, and claws. These features demand precision and a thoughtful approach to shading to bring out their texture and realism. A steady hand, the right brushes, and a strategic color palette are your tools for transforming a static model into a dynamic, lifelike creature.
Fine details like scales require fine brushes. Invest in a set of precision brushes with varying tip sizes, ideally ranging from 000 to 2. These allow you to control paint flow and create sharp, defined edges. For scales, start with a base coat in a mid-tone shade. Once dry, use a slightly darker shade to define the edges of each scale, creating a sense of depth. For a truly realistic effect, consider dry brushing – lightly dipping your brush in a lighter shade and gently brushing it over the raised areas of the scales.
Teeth and claws, being prominent features, deserve special attention. Begin with a base coat of off-white or ivory. Once dry, use a thin brush and a dark brown or black shade to carefully paint the gum line and the crevices between teeth. This adds depth and realism. For claws, a similar technique applies. After a base coat, use a darker shade to define the tips and any natural ridges or grooves. A touch of metallic paint along the edges can suggest wear and tear, adding a layer of authenticity.
Remember, less is often more. Subtle shading and highlighting are key to achieving a natural look. Avoid overloading your brush with paint, as this can lead to blobs and smudges. Thin layers, built up gradually, allow for better control and a more refined finish. Practice on a separate piece of plastic or cardboard before tackling your T-Rex to get a feel for the brush and paint consistency.

Weathering Effects: Adding dirt, scratches, and wear for a realistic, aged dinosaur appearance
A well-executed weathering effect can transform a pristine 3D printed T-Rex into a lifelike relic of a bygone era. The key lies in understanding how natural elements interact with surfaces over time, then replicating those effects with precision. Start by observing real-world examples: rocks, metal, and even aged plastic toys. Notice how dirt accumulates in crevices, scratches follow natural wear patterns, and wear reveals underlying layers. These observations will guide your technique, ensuring authenticity in your dinosaur’s aged appearance.
To begin, gather your materials: acrylic paints in earthy tones (browns, grays, ochres), a soft-bristled brush, a fine-tipped tool for scratching, and a matte sealant. Start by applying a base coat of paint, allowing it to dry completely. Next, use a dry brushing technique to add dirt. Dip your brush in a dark brown or gray paint, wipe off most of it on a cloth, and lightly sweep it across raised surfaces and edges. This mimics dust accumulation and highlights texture. For deeper crevices, use a wash—a heavily diluted paint mixture—to settle into recesses, creating a natural grime effect.
Scratches and wear require a more deliberate approach. Use a fine-tipped tool or the edge of a knife to gently scrape away small sections of paint, revealing the base color or primer beneath. Focus on areas prone to friction, such as the T-Rex’s claws, teeth, and joints. For a more dramatic effect, layer scratches by adding thin lines of metallic paint to simulate exposed material. Remember, less is often more—overdoing it can make the model look damaged rather than aged.
Finally, seal your work with a matte finish to protect the paint and enhance realism. Avoid glossy sealants, as they can detract from the weathered look. Step back and assess your T-Rex from different angles, ensuring the weathering effects are consistent and believable. By carefully layering dirt, scratches, and wear, you’ll achieve a dinosaur that appears to have survived millions of years, ready to dominate any display or diorama.

Sealing and Finishing: Protecting the paint job with clear coats for durability and shine
A painted 3D-printed T-Rex, with its intricate details and vibrant colors, deserves protection. Clear coats act as the unsung heroes, shielding your masterpiece from the ravages of time, dust, and handling. Think of them as a suit of armor, preserving the paint job's brilliance and ensuring your T-Rex remains a conversation starter for years to come.
Unlike a simple topcoat, clear coats offer a multi-faceted defense. They provide a physical barrier against scratches, chips, and fading caused by UV rays. Additionally, they enhance the paint's depth and gloss, giving your T-Rex a professional, museum-quality finish.
Choosing the right clear coat is crucial. Opt for a product specifically formulated for plastics, as 3D printing materials can react differently to various coatings. Acrylic-based clear coats are a popular choice due to their ease of use, quick drying time, and compatibility with most paints. For maximum durability, consider polyurethane clear coats, which offer superior scratch resistance but require more ventilation during application due to their stronger fumes.
Spraying is the preferred method for applying clear coats, ensuring a smooth, even finish. Hold the can 6-8 inches away from the surface and apply thin, overlapping coats, allowing each layer to dry completely before adding the next. Multiple thin coats are better than one thick coat, preventing drips and ensuring a flawless result.
Remember, patience is key. Rushing the drying process can lead to imperfections. Allow ample time for each coat to cure fully, following the manufacturer's instructions. This investment in time will be rewarded with a T-Rex that boasts a stunning, long-lasting finish, ready to roar its way into the spotlight.
